Job Description
We are seeking a skilled and detail-oriented Data Remediator to ensure digital documents and web content meet WCAG 2.1 AA accessibility standards. This role is essential in making content inclusive and usable for individuals with disabilities, including those who are blind, deaf, or have cognitive or motor impairments.
As a Data Remediation Specialist, the individual is responsible for tagging and remediating PDF documents to ensure they meet accessibility and compliance standards under WCAG 2.1 Level AA. They apply and validate Optical Character Recognition (OCR) on scanned documents to guarantee that all content is both readable and searchable. Their work includes reviewing and correcting document structures such as headings, lists, tables, and alternative text for images to ensure proper formatting and accessibility. In addition to document remediation, they need to have a strong understanding of HTML so they can effectively read the current tags and know how to structure new tagging.

Required Skills & Experience
• Experience in document remediation and accessibility tagging (PDF and HTML).
• Strong knowledge of WCAG 2.1 AA, Section 508, and other accessibility standards.
• Proficiency with tools such as Adobe Acrobat Pro DC, CommonLook, PAC 3, and OCR software.
• Familiarity with HTML for clear understanding of tagging accessibility and semantic structure.
Excellent attention to detail and organizational skills.
Nice to Have Skills & Experience
• Accessibility certifications (e.g., CPACC, WAS).
• Experience with automated and manual accessibility testing.
Knowledge of inclusive design principles and usability for diverse audiences.
